- [ ] **Walk the new starter round the bike cage and parking gates.** Show them the cage behind Ostler Court — it's the blue one, not the contractor lockup next to it. Explain that the car park gates at Finchwick House open automatically on the way in but need a swipe on the way out. Both the cage padlock panel and the exit gate keypad at Merrowby Campus accept the same entry code, which is below.

door code, yagap-bahof: bdg-O-05

Hey, welcome aboard! This PR wires the Snapquill barcode scanner into the Cartmule checkout flow. Main change is a debounce layer so double-scans don't add duplicate items — the hardware fires fast. I also bumped the decode timeout after testing with worn labels. All the knobs live in one place, listed here.

tuning table, kajog-kawef:
PRIORITIES = {
    "kelox": 870,
    "kasix": 89,
    "eliax": 988,
}

Finance Review Summary — Harlequin Mills Ltd

For branch managers: the licensing dispute with Orvander Technics over the Greyline patent remains unresolved. Provisioned costs rose modestly this quarter, covering external counsel and a contingency for settlement. Revenue from affected product lines is stable, though new licensing deals are paused. No branch-level action is required at this stage. The related business-plan note appears below.

board note of fahif-yahog: Gross margin on Wenath came in at 10 percent against a plan of 5 percent. Only 3 of the 100 pilot accounts renewed Wenath, so a churn review is set for July 15.

## Ticket: Config drift in Lantern Catalogue importer

The nightly MARC import on the Westbrook node has drifted from the version-controlled baseline: batch size and retry limits were edited manually during the April incident and never committed. Future maintainers should reconcile against the repository before changing anything. For reference, the node's current live configuration values are recorded below.

config for faduf-fahip:
ELIAX_LOG_LEVEL=error
ELIAX_METRICS_HOST=metrics.eliax.zemvarcorp.corp
ELIAX_POOL_SIZE=16